    David Weddle is an American television writer and producer known for episodes of Star Trek: Deep Space Nine (19961999), The Twilight Zone (20022003), Battlestar Galactica (20042009), CSI: Crime Scene Investigation (2009-2011), Falling Skies (2011-2013), and The Strain (2014-2017) with writing partner Bradley Thompson.
